Appropriate Preposition:

  • Taste for ( রুচি ) She has no taste for music.
  • Indulge in ( আসক্ত হওয়া ) He indulge in drugs.
  • Look at ( তাকানো ) Look at the moon.
  • Junior to ( নিম্নপদস্থ ; বয়সে কম ) He is junior to me in service.
  • Engaged in ( নিযুক্ত (কাজে) ) I was engaged with him in talk.
  • Dislike for ( অপছন্দ ) He has dislike for dogs.

Idioms:

  • be on ones back ( একেবারে কুপোকাত )
  • Beat about the bush ( কাজের কথায় না এসে আজেবাজে কথা বলা ) Please come to the point without beating about the bush
  • know from a bare hint ( এক আঁচরেই বোঝা )
  • To the backbone ( হাড়ে হাড়ে ) The boy is wicked to the backbone.
  • By leaps and bounds ( অতি দ্রুতগতিতে ) The population of Bangladesh is increasing by leaps and bounds.
  • Hard nut to crack ( কঠিন সমস্যা ) The problem of adult education is really a hard nut to crack.
